If x = (5 + 331/2)/4 then find the value of 8x3 + 6x2 - 69x + 20 ?1. -332. +333. 04. 1

Answer» Correct Answer - Option 2 : +33

Given:

x = (5 + 331/2)/4

Calculation:

4x - 5 = 331/2

Squaring both sides we get,

16x2 + 25 - 40x = 33

16x2 -40x - 8 = 0

2x2 - 5x - 1 = 0       ----(1)

To find:

The value of 8x3 + 6x2 -69x + 20 = ?

Calculation:

Taking eq(1) and multiplying it by some factors to get the evaluating part. firstly we will multiply eq(1) by 4x in order to get the first term of evaluating part (8x3) then we will multiply the 13.

4x (2x2 - 5x - 1) + 13 (2x2 - 5x - 1) = 0

On solving and addition and subtraction of 20 above we get,

8x3 + 6x2 -69x -13 + 20 - 20 =0

8x3 + 6x2 -69x + 20 = 33
